Online Class Availability at Western Washington University
Many students take online classes at Western Washington University. Among 14,710 students, 226 (2%) studied exclusively online and 1,421 (10%) took at least some classes online.

Statistics Bachelor’s Program at Western Washington University
Of the 6 bachelor’s statistics graduates at Western Washington University, 0% were women (0) and 100% were men (6).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Statistics bachelor’s degree recipients at Western Washington University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 2 |
| Two or More Races | 2 |
| Unknown | 2 |
Minority students account for 33% of Statistics bachelor’s degree recipients at Western Washington University, below the national average of 38%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
